9. How does the election cycle for House of Representatives members compare

to that of U.S. Senators?
A. They have lifetime terms.
B. House members run every four years, while Senators run every six years.
C. House members run every six years, while Senators run every four years.
D. House members run every two years and Senators run every
six years.

Final answer:

The election cycle for House of Representatives members is every two years, while U.S. Senators run every six years.


Step-by-step explanation:

The election cycle for House of Representatives members differs from that of U.S. Senators. House members run every two years, while Senators run every six years.
